What happened
Delhivery has announced a long-term partnership with Zen Mobility to deploy thousands of purpose-built electric vehicles across India over the next 3-5 years. This builds on an existing base of over 500 operational EVs, signaling a significant scale-up in their electric fleet for last-mile and mid-mile logistics.
Why it matters
This collaboration is crucial for the Indian logistics sector's transition to green mobility, offering potential cost savings through reduced fuel expenses and improved operational efficiency for Delhivery. It also highlights the growing demand for commercial EVs, which is a positive catalyst for the broader EV manufacturing and charging infrastructure ecosystem in India.
